John Oscar ULRICK

ULRICK, John Oscar

Service Number: 2168
Enlisted: 28 April 1916, Enlisted at Lismore, NSW
Last Rank: Lance Corporal
Last Unit: 41st Infantry Battalion
Born: Berry, New South Wales, Australia, 28 August 1898
Home Town: Ulmarra, Clarence Valley, New South Wales
Schooling: Not yet discovered
Occupation: Farmer
Died: Maclean, New South Wales, Australia, 9 November 1965, aged 67 years, cause of death not yet discovered
Cemetery: Grafton Cemetery, NSW
PLOT Meth. I11. MEMORIAL ID 48643670
Memorials: Ulmarra Public School WW1 Roll of Honour

World War 1 Service

28 Apr 1916: Enlisted AIF WW1, Private, 2168, 41st Infantry Battalion, Enlisted at Lismore, NSW
7 Sep 1916: Involvement Private, 2168, 41st Infantry Battalion, --- :embarkation_roll: roll_number: '18' embarkation_place: Brisbane embarkation_ship: HMAT Clan McGillivray embarkation_ship_number: A46 public_note: ''
7 Sep 1916: Embarked Private, 2168, 41st Infantry Battalion, HMAT Clan McGillivray, Brisbane

7 Jan 1917: Involvement AIF WW1, Private, 2168, 41st Infantry Battalion

World War 1 Service

6 Oct 1918: Promoted AIF WW1, Lance Corporal, 41st Infantry Battalion
2 Oct 1919: Discharged AIF WW1, Lance Corporal, 2168, 41st Infantry Battalion, Discharged at the 1st Military District

Biography contributed by Carol Foster

Son of Adam Ulrick and Maggie Ulrick of Berry, NSW

Commenced return to Australia on 21 June 1919 aboard Konigin Luise disembarking on 16 August 1918

Medals: British War Medal, Victory Medal

During 1921c John married Elizabeth A.M. Neville in Sydney, NSW
